Block enforced changes to junior level Rugby rules. The UK is blessed with a wealth of passionate coaches that know how to train teams safely.

On the 18/02/14 Professor of Public Health, Allyson Pollock spoke to Sky Sports saying that the rules of junior level Rugby are too dangerous.

"..we actually have to move to change the rules of the game, as well as putting in other preventions strategies...we may need to think fundamentally about changing the game for children..so it evolves and becomes a very different game from the very brutal game that we are seeing the professional players play at the moment."

The current rules contribute tremendously towards a game that develops so many of the attributes that individuals strive for such as determination, empathy, team spirit, passion and integrity. Those who engage in Rugby, no mater what their age understand the challenges, risks but also the rewards involved.

Safe training is the key, not the government on the pitch.
